#7 - S.T.A.R Labs
The Science and Technology Advanced Research Laboratories, usually shortened to S.T.A.R. Labs, was a research organization founded by a scientist named Garrison Slate, who wanted a nationwide chain of research laboratories unconnected to the government or any business interests.[1] He succeeded not only on a national scale, but an international one as well: S.T.A.R. Labs maintained facilities in Canada, Europe, Australia and Japan as well as in the United States, with the total number of facilities numbering between twenty and thirty at last recorded count.
